This 4-star-superior hotel in Berlin's Neukölln district is part of a large convention and entertainment center. It has live shows, a spa, and a direct bus link to Schönefeld Airport. Free Wi-Fi is available.
The spacious rooms at the Estrel Hotel Berlin are decorated in soft, natural colors. Each room is air-conditioned and features soundproof windows. The stylish bathroom includes a bathtub and hairdryer.
International cuisine is served in the Estrel’s 5 restaurants. These are in the large, Mediterranean-style atrium. There are also 3 bars, a smoking lounge and a garden overlooking the Neukölln canal.
Musical and comedy concerts are shown on site. Guests can also relax in the Estrel’s sauna or work out in the gym.
Sonnenallee S-Bahn Station is just a 2-minute walk from the Estrel Berlin. Trains run directly to the ICC Exhibition Centre.
